James Franklin Brooksby papers, before 2014 August 2
File includes an emailed copy of James Franklin Brooksby's obituary, a brief military autobiography, and a brief history of the 379th Bombardment Group. There is also a map of Europe showing his 35 flight missions during the war. Dated before August 2, 2014.
